Steven K. Wood
May 15, 1940 - Sept. 22, 2023
SULLIVAN - Steven K. Wood, 83, of Sullivan, passed away September 22, 2023.
Visitation will be held Saturday October 7, 2023 from 10:00 a.m. to 1:00 p.m. at the Reed Funeral Home, Sullivan, IL. Military Honors will be conducted by the Sullivan American Legion Post #68 at 9:30 a.m. Saturday at the Reed Funeral Home.
Steve was born May 15, 1940 in Decatur, the son of Ivan D. "Cotton" and Geraldine E. (Barger) Wood. After he graduated from Sullivan High School in 1958, he attended the University of Idaho, where he was a member of the Theta Chi fraternity, and the Reserve Officers Training Corps. He graduated in 1962 with a degree in political science.
Steve met his wife, Kathy, while attending college. They married on June 16, 1962, and shipped off to Bamberg, Germany, where they lived for 2 years while Steve served in the US Army F Troop 2nd Armored Cavalry Regiment.
After his military service, Steve attended the University of Illinois College of Law, graduating in 1971. Following graduation, he and Kathy moved back to Sullivan, where Steve practiced law for the remainder of his life. During his 50+ year career, Steve was the attorney for the City of Sullivan and other area municipalities, townships, fire districts, as well as representing clients from all around the United States.
Steve was a member of the Sullivan AMBUCS, and served as their Scholarship Committee Chairman. He was a member of the Moultrie County Bar Association, the Illinois State Bar Association, a 50 year member of the Sullivan Lions Club, a member of the George A. Sentel Masonic Lodge #764, and of the Sullivan American Legion Post #68. He was a member throughout his life of the Sullivan First United Methodist Church. He was a member of the Prairieland Frontiersmen for over 40 years, and served for many years as a board member, and secretary.
Steve is survived by his children, Michael Wood of Camdenton, MO, Leslie Wood (John Dowdy) of Glen Carbon, IL and his grandchildren, Erin and Caspar Dowdy.
He was preceded in death by his parents, his wife Kathy, and his brother Stanley Wood.
